Precisely what is a Swimming Pool Lifeguard Training course?
A swimming pool lifeguard program is really a nationally recognised instruction system made to prepare men and women to supervise aquatic environments like community pools, drinking water parks, and leisure centres. The program presents equally theoretical and hands-on instruction in:

H2o basic safety and hazard identification

Rescue methods for mindful and unconscious swimmers

Basic daily life support and c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R)

Initially help reaction in aquatic environments

Crowd supervision and incident prevention

The study course follows specific instruction units, often Section of countrywide skills within the sport and recreation teaching offer.

Stipulations and Entry Specifications
To enrol in a regular swimming pool lifeguard study course, candidates are usually anticipated to fulfill the subsequent:

Be a minimum of 16 many years old (some courses acknowledge 15-yr-olds with consent)

Have the ability to swim two hundred metres in under six minutes

Be capable of retrieving a 5kg object from The underside of a pool (2m deep)

Have fantastic verbal communication and literacy in English

Be fairly fit and physically effective at handling rescue jobs

Conference these specifications makes certain that trainees can properly execute rescues and answer in large-force scenarios.

Program Written content: Whatever you'll Discover
Swimming pool lifeguard programs address a combination of classroom periods, pool-centered practicals, and situation screening.

Regular course models incorporate:

Provide Very first Support (HLTAID011)

Provide CPR (HLTAID009)

Supervise Swimming Pool End users (SISCAQU027)

Perform Standard H2o Rescues (SISCAQU022)

Carry out Drinking water Rescues (SISCAQU020)

Matters involve:

Rescue strategies: access, toss, As well as in-water helps

Surveillance methods: scanning, zoning, and positioning

Emergency reaction: motion strategies, inform techniques, conversation

Handling spinal injuries inside the water

Pool safety procedures and danger assessments

How to handle tough patrons or emergency situations

Evaluation incorporates published assessments, timed swims, simulated emergencies, and group activities.

How much time Does the Study course Take?
Most classes get 2–three entire days to accomplish, based on the training company. Some present blended Finding out formats with pre-training course reading through or on the internet modules followed by simple periods.

Courses are often shipped in Neighborhood leisure centres, aquatic amenities, or teaching colleges. Weekend and vacation class dates are sometimes available to go well with students or Performing participants.

Price of a Swimming Pool Lifeguard Course
The associated fee may differ by supplier and site, but most courses selection between $250 and $400. This ordinarily contains:

Study course instruction and supplies

Simple assessments

Very first support and CPR units

Statement of Attainment on completion

Some businesses or councils could subsidise service fees for folks making use of to operate of their aquatic centres. It’s worth checking for regional courses or occupation-connected sponsorships.

Certification Validity and Ongoing Necessities
Lifeguard skills are certainly not lifelong—techniques should be refreshed.

CPR models ought to ordinarily be renewed each individual twelve months

Whole lifeguard recertification is usually essential every single 2–3 years

Ongoing in-service training is commonly Component of employment in aquatic centres

Retaining your certification present ensures you might be generally current with the most recent safety protocols and rescue solutions.
